Update: Drupal internationalize core in Drupal 6

I've been catching up with recent Drupal developments and it's looking very good for multilingual support in the next version (6). There will be a code freeze for 6 July 1st at which point I'll review how far along they got and decide if it's worth moving ahead with rolling our own in the current version or waiting for 6.

Things looks like they're moving quickly, so it may actually be faster, and certainly easier to maintain over the long run, if we hold off until the release of Drupal 6 later this year. In the meantime, we can focus on working out the mechanics of what the experience should be for users moving between Wikitravel & Extra in different languages...
